Army jet makes gear-up landing at Elmendorf

An Army aircraft made a gear-up landing on an Elmendorf airstrip Tuesday, though no injuries were reported.
The Cessna Citation-560 aircraft was scheduled to land on the main strip and radioed ahead it was having mechanical problems with its gear, Air Force spokesman Master Sgt. Mikal Canfield said.

An Army Citation-560 aircraft was forced to perform a gear-up landing at the Elmendorf airfield at 3:24 p.m. Oct. 6, 2009. Emergency response personnel quickly arrived at the scene; three people were on board no one was injured at the accident.
